Switching on the unit
Apply supply voltage to terminals A1 and A2,
Ca. 2s long, all LEDs and the digital display illuminate (
8.8.8.8.
)
The TR800Web is now ready to operate
In the digital display,
boot
flashes (alternating with sensor value), the integrated webserver
starts (duration ca. 1-2 minutes). After
boot
extinguishes, the unit can be addressed via its
interfaces.
6.1 Find the unit in the network
Prerequisite: Web browser Internet Explorer 7,8 or Firefox 3 (tested).
The TR800Web provides four facilities to find itself in the network:
6.1.1 DHCP server
In the network, there is a DHCP server; newly added units automatically are assigned an IP
address
Query of the IP address in the unit
Press the DOWN button 2x, then the SET button
IP address appears in the digital display
Status of DHCP query is displayed (
off
/
on
/
FAIL
)
Start web browser and enter the IP address in the address line [Return]
The TR800Web homepage opens in the web browser
Close the login window with the OK button (without user name and without password)
If the network logon fails via DHCP, a network configuration will be performed based on zeroconf (IP
= 169.254.x.x).
6.1.2 Default IP- Address 10.10.10.10
! Use this setting for configuration only.
Push slide switch to IP 10.10.10.10 (sketch Point 8.8)
Requires a reboot of webserver (press RESET button), in the digital display
boot
flashes (start duration ca. 1 min)
User management is deactivated, http-Port = 80 und https-Port = 443
Note: The following actions can only be performed with administrator rights.
Enter this command into your PC in the input prompt (command line):
route add 10.10.10.10 x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x
(x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x= IP address of PC)
Route for the TR800Web
ping 10.10.10.10
Connection test
TR800Web replies
Reply from 10.10.10.10: Bytes=32 Time=3ms TTL=32
Reply from 10.10.10.10: Bytes=32 Time=1ms TTL=32
Ping statistic for 10.10.10.10:
Package: Sent = 4, Received = 4, Lost = 0 (0% loss),
Connection okay
